Francis,
there is another, well tested C# access using
http://www.xmlblaster.org/xmlBlaster/doc/requirements/client.c.windowsCE.html
(see
http://www.xmlblaster.org/xmlBlaster/doc/requirements/client.csharp.html
overview).
It uses all the features of the C SOCKET client libraries (like
tunneling callback through the
same socket, zlib streaming compression etc).
Depending on your use case, this socket approach is probably the way to go.
